Welcome to on-call for the Glimmerpane design system! Our snapshot tests live in the `snapcheck` suite and run on every merge to main. If a UI component changes visually, the diff bot flags it — usually it's an intentional tweak, so just approve the new baseline. If it's 2am and snapshots are failing across the board, it's almost always a font-loading race, not your problem. To unlock the baseline store and re-approve snapshots in bulk, use the recovery passphrase below.

recovery phrase for tahag-taguf: wenix-caswyn

/*
 * ReminderBot client setup — Bexley Clinic scheduling.
 * Job runs hourly, pulls tomorrow's appointments from the
 * Calvect scheduling API, sends SMS via the internal notify
 * service. Retries are handled upstream; don't add your own.
 * Rate limit: 50 req/min, enforced server-side. Timeouts
 * beyond 10s mean the notify service is down — page platform.
 * The client authenticates with the internal key below.
 */

app token of bahaf-tajeg = zpat23_SjjsllwiLmXbtS65veZaV47

Dear colleagues,

Ahead of Thursday's session, a careful summary of the renewal position for Calder & Frome Logistics. The incumbent insurer has quoted a 9% premium increase, citing sector-wide claims inflation rather than our own record, which remains clean. An alternative quote from Merrowgate Underwriting offers marginally lower cost but narrower liability cover on cross-border haulage. My recommendation is to renew with the incumbent while negotiating a two-year rate lock. The confidential rationale is set out immediately below.

board note of fahif-yahog: Gross margin on Wenath came in at 10 percent against a plan of 5 percent. Only 3 of the 100 pilot accounts renewed Wenath, so a churn review is set for July 15.

## Onboarding: Dedupe Pipeline (Mergewell)

The Mergewell dedupe job reconciles customer records nightly across the Corvin and Ashfield regions. Before paging anyone, verify the matcher service is healthy and the candidate queue is draining. Run all commands from the ops bastion, never your laptop. The job authenticates to the record store via an env file; add the credential line directly below.

sealed setting: VAULT_KEY3=eec